Ingredients
Scale
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1.5 lbs)
- 1 cup pineapple chunks (fresh or canned)
- 1 cup bell peppers (mixed colors)
- 1 medium red onion (sliced)
- ½ cup teriyaki sauce
- 2 tsp garlic powder
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- Salt & pepper to taste
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 400°F.
- In a large bowl, toss chicken breasts with olive oil, garlic powder, salt, and pepper until evenly coated.
- Add bell peppers, red onion slices, and pineapple chunks to the bowl along with half of the teriyaki sauce; mix well.
- Arrange the mixture in a single layer on a sheet pan lined with parchment paper.
- Bake for 25-30 minutes or until ch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F.
- Drizzle remaining teriyaki sauce over the dish before serving.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es

Nutrition
- Serving Size: 1 chicken breast with vegetables (approx. 300g)
- Calories: 320
- Sugar: 10g
- Sodium: 680mg
- Fat: 8g
- Saturated Fat: 1g
- Unsaturated Fat: 6g
- Trans Fat: 0g
- Carbohydrates: 32g
- Fiber: 3g
- Protein: 29g
- Cholesterol: 90mg
